The provided text describes the structured process for adding new HTML and CSS features to Blink, Chrome's rendering engine. It details the multi-stage workflow, starting from incubation with explainer documents and early feedback, through prototyping the feature behind a runtime flag in C++ code. The explanation then covers implementing both HTML and CSS features, including defining Web IDL interfaces for HTML or updating CSS property definitions in JSON5, and ultimately, ensuring robust platform testing using Web Platform Tests (WPT) to guarantee interoperability and prevent regressions. This methodical approach ensures that new web features are carefully developed, tested, and aligned with web standards before being shipped to users.
